The most vital component of any rehabilitation program is the knowledge base and effectiveness of the therapists themselves. For this reason Baptist Rehab-Germantown is committed to maintaining long-tenured and highly trained rehabilitation therapists equipped with the facilities, equipment, and technology needed to produce optimal outcomes.
Among the offerings at Baptist Rehab-Germantown are un-weighing treadmill systems and aquatic therapies for assistance with early ambulation, dynamic functional splinting programs for the upper extremity, and functional electrical stimulation programs for upper extremity, lower extremity and swallowing rehabilitation. Speech therapists have access to a comprehensive diagnostic department and onsite radiologists for modified barium swallowing assessments. Our Neurocom Balance master with long-force plate is a computerized system that provides objective assessment, feedback, and training for balance through a variety of functional movements and activities. And a computerized multicervical unit (MCU) allows for targeted assessment and strengthening of the complex system of muscles supporting the head and neck.
Through generous donations from the Baptist Memorial Health Care Foundation, Baptist Rehab-Germantown is proud to have implemented several firsts in neurologic rehabilitation in the Memphis area. We were the first to offer VitalStim therapy for swallowing, the first to offer Saeboflex dymanic splinting system for the upper extremity, and most recently, the first to implement the Bioness electrical stimulation program for the lower extremity as well as a comprehensive Bioness program for upper and lower extremity in both the inpatient and outpatient settings.
